nwjs初体验

因为有需要基于h5开发桌面应用,所以初略体验了下njws。

看它的说明:NW.js 是基于 Chromium 和 Node.js 运行的, 以前也叫nodeWebkit。这就给了你使用HTML和JavaScript来制作桌面应用的可能。在应用里你可以直接调用Node.js的各种api以及现有的第三方包。
我的初步理解是这东西就是个桌面版本的app的壳+chromium浏览器内核。

1.先从官网下载https://nwjs.io/。解压好。将目录假如PATH,方便敲nw。
2.先按照教程建个简单项目
写个test.html文件

<!DOCTYPE html>
<html>
  <head>
    <title>Hello World!</title>
  </head>
  <body>
    <h1>Hello World!</h1>
    We are using node.js <script>document.write(process.version)</script>.
  </body>
</html>

同级目录下在建立一个package.json

{
  "name": "nw-demo",
  "version": "0.0.1",
  "main": "test.html"
}

运行nw .
这里写图片描述

4.进入实际工程,由于之前有同事已经在维护这个工程,所以导入工程,选择run配置,点+号选择nw.js

5.设置服务器调用地址。
$env.setServerContextUrl(“http://**********:9380/*****4/”);

run!成功。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值